Abstract

Regional development planning isaimed at achieving harmony and balance in development between regions in accordance with their natural potential and utilizing this potential in an efficient, orderly and safe manner. The purpose of this study was to see the role of socio-economic impacts on the planning of the Siosar tourism village area. This research method is a quantitative study by testing the hypothesis of the socio-economic influence of the community on regional planning in Siosar Village, Karo Regency. By involving 559 samples of family heads to be distributed research questionnaires and data processing using SEM-PLS. The results of the study stated that there is a Socio-Economic influence of the community (X) on Regional Development (Y) because it has a P value of 0.009 which is smaller than the significant level of 0.05.
